Vasile Andru (1942, Bachrinest, Romania). Graduated at the Faculty of Philology in Jash. After seven years of teaching History of French literature and Aesthetics, he quit the position of the professor and devoted his time to writing. Since 1978 works at the “Romanian life” magazine.
He writes novels, short fiction, and essays.
Member of the Writers’ Association of Romania.
His books include: The Groom (1975), Archeology of wishes (1977), The Tzar’s Night (1979), The Tower (1985), Life and Sign (1989), Remembering the text (1992), India: The Visible and the Unvisible (1993), Therapy of the Destiny (1994), Prose. Essays. Interviews (1995), Birds of the Sky (1999)…
